Составители:
Рубрика:
5
ОГЛАВЛЕНИЕ
ВВЕДЕНИЕ......................................................................................... 7
ГЛАВА 1. ОСНОВНЫЕ СВЕДЕНИЯ О РАБОТЕ
НА ПЕРСОНАЛЬНОМ КОМПЬЮТЕРЕ..................... 8
1.1. Конфигурация персонального компьютера.......... 8
1.2. Файловая система MS DOS.................................. 11
1.3. Команды MS DOS ................................................. 14
1.4. Инструментальная система NC............................ 16
1.5. Контрольные вопросы и задание......................... 20
ГЛАВА 2. РАБОТА В ИНТЕГРИРОВАННОЙ СРЕДЕ ТУРБО
ПАСКАЛЬ 7.0............................................................... 23
2.1. Организация вычислений в среде
Турбо Паскаль ...................................................... 23
2.2. Главное меню ........................................................ 25
2.3. Работа с окнами..................................................... 29
2.4. Текстовый редактор.............................................. 30
2.5. Интегрированный отладчик................................. 31
ГЛАВА 3. ПРОСТЕЙШИЕ КОНСТРУКЦИИ ЯЗЫКА
ТУРБО ПАСКАЛЬ....................................................... 34
3.1. Алфавит языка....................................................... 34
3.2. Константы и переменные ..................................... 34
3.3. Арифметические выражения ............................... 37
3.4. Контрольные задания ........................................... 40
ГЛАВА 4. ЛИНЕЙНЫЕ ВЫЧИСЛИТЕЛЬНЫЕ ПРОЦЕССЫ... 45
4.1. Оператор присваивания........................................ 45
4.2. Операторы ввода-вывода ..................................... 46
4.3. Структура основной программы ......................... 49
4.4. Контрольные задания ........................................... 51
ГЛАВА 5. РАЗВЕТВЛЯЮЩИЕСЯ ВЫЧИСЛИТЕЛЬНЫЕ
ПРОЦЕССЫ ................................................................. 55
5.1. Логические выражения......................................... 55
5.2. Условные операторы ............................................ 57
5.3. Оператор выбора................................................... 65
5.4. Контрольные задания ........................................... 67
6
ГЛАВА 6. ЦИКЛИЧЕСКИЕ ВЫЧИСЛИТЕЛЬНЫЕ
ПРОЦЕССЫ ................................................................. 70
6.1. Операторы цикла с условием............................... 70
6.2. Операторы цикла с параметром........................... 74
6.3. Базовые алгоритмы ............................................... 76
6.4. Кратные циклы...................................................... 80
ГЛАВА 7. МАССИВЫ................................................................... 82
7.1. Понятие массива ................................................... 82
7.2. Одномерные массивы ........................................... 82
7.3. Двухмерные массивы............................................ 87
ГЛАВА 8. ПОДПРОГРАММЫ ..................................................... 94
8.1. Структура сложной программы........................... 94
8.2. Процедуры............................................................. 95
8.3. Функции................................................................. 99
8.4. Параметры-массивы............................................ 101
8.5. Примеры программирования задач
с использованием подпрограмм........................ 102
ГЛАВА 9. ТЕКСТОВЫЕ ДАННЫЕ ........................................... 112
9.1. Символьный тип данных.................................... 112
9.2. Строковый тип данных....................................... 114
9.3. Контрольное задание .......................................... 118
ГЛАВА 10. ЗАПИСИ И ФАЙЛЫ ДАННЫХ............................... 121
10.1. Понятие записи.................................................. 121
10.2. Файлы данных ................................................... 122
10.3. Пример решения задачи создания документа 126
10.4. Контрольное задание........................................ 129
ЗАКЛЮЧЕНИЕ............................................................................... 131
БИБЛИОГРАФИЧЕСКИЙ СПИСОК........................................... 132
ПРИЛОЖЕНИЕ 1. СООБЩЕНИЯ ОБ ОШИБКАХ .................... 133
ПРИЛОЖЕНИЕ 2. ТАБЛИЦА АЛЬТЕРНАТИВНОЙ
КОДИРОВКИ СИМВОЛОВ ..................................... 138
О Г Л АВ Л Е Н И Е ГЛАВА 6. ЦИКЛИЧЕСКИЕ ВЫЧИСЛИТЕЛЬНЫЕ ПРОЦЕССЫ ................................................................. 70 ВВЕДЕНИЕ ......................................................................................... 7 6.1. Операторы цикла с условием............................... 70 ГЛАВА 1. ОСНОВНЫЕ СВЕДЕНИЯ О РАБОТЕ 6.2. Операторы цикла с параметром........................... 74 НА ПЕРСОНАЛЬНОМ КОМПЬЮТЕРЕ..................... 8 6.3. Базовые алгоритмы ............................................... 76 1.1. Конфигурация персонального компьютера.......... 8 6.4. Кратные циклы ...................................................... 80 1.2. Файловая система MS DOS.................................. 11 ГЛАВА 7. МАССИВЫ ................................................................... 82 1.3. Команды MS DOS ................................................. 14 7.1. Понятие массива ................................................... 82 1.4. Инструментальная система NC............................ 16 7.2. Одномерные массивы ........................................... 82 1.5. Контрольные вопросы и задание ......................... 20 7.3. Двухмерные массивы............................................ 87 ГЛАВА 2. РАБОТА В ИНТЕГРИРОВАННОЙ СРЕДЕ ТУРБО ГЛАВА 8. ПОДПРОГРАММЫ ..................................................... 94 ПАСКАЛЬ 7.0............................................................... 23 8.1. Структура сложной программы........................... 94 2.1. Организация вычислений в среде 8.2. Процедуры ............................................................. 95 Турбо Паскаль ...................................................... 23 8.3. Функции ................................................................. 99 2.2. Главное меню ........................................................ 25 8.4. Параметры-массивы............................................ 101 2.3. Работа с окнами..................................................... 29 8.5. Примеры программирования задач 2.4. Текстовый редактор .............................................. 30 с использованием подпрограмм........................ 102 2.5. Интегрированный отладчик ................................. 31 ГЛАВА 9. ТЕКСТОВЫЕ ДАННЫЕ ........................................... 112 ГЛАВА 3. ПРОСТЕЙШИЕ КОНСТРУКЦИИ ЯЗЫКА 9.1. Символьный тип данных.................................... 112 ТУРБО ПАСКАЛЬ ....................................................... 34 9.2. Строковый тип данных....................................... 114 3.1. Алфавит языка....................................................... 34 9.3. Контрольное задание .......................................... 118 3.2. Константы и переменные ..................................... 34 ГЛАВА 10. ЗАПИСИ И ФАЙЛЫ ДАННЫХ............................... 121 3.3. Арифметические выражения ............................... 37 3.4. Контрольные задания ........................................... 40 10.1. Понятие записи.................................................. 121 10.2. Файлы данных ................................................... 122 ГЛАВА 4. ЛИНЕЙНЫЕ ВЫЧИСЛИТЕЛЬНЫЕ ПРОЦЕССЫ... 45 10.3. Пример решения задачи создания документа 126 4.1. Оператор присваивания........................................ 45 10.4. Контрольное задание ........................................ 129 4.2. Операторы ввода-вывода ..................................... 46 ЗАКЛЮЧЕНИЕ............................................................................... 131 4.3. Структура основной программы ......................... 49 4.4. Контрольные задания ........................................... 51 БИБЛИОГРАФИЧЕСКИЙ СПИСОК ........................................... 132 ГЛАВА 5. РАЗВЕТВЛЯЮЩИЕСЯ ВЫЧИСЛИТЕЛЬНЫЕ ПРИЛОЖЕНИЕ 1. СООБЩЕНИЯ ОБ ОШИБКАХ .................... 133 ПРОЦЕССЫ ................................................................. 55 ПРИЛОЖЕНИЕ 2. ТАБЛИЦА АЛЬТЕРНАТИВНОЙ 5.1. Логические выражения......................................... 55 КОДИРОВКИ СИМВОЛОВ ..................................... 138 5.2. Условные операторы ............................................ 57 5.3. Оператор выбора ................................................... 65 5.4. Контрольные задания ........................................... 67 5 6